Transaction

62c806633c4af0801fc0a71c02b71e881c431fcf2565322a85cb8ef7f573211d

Summary

In Block301687
TimeMon, 07 Aug 2023 01:36:45 UTC
Total Input571.93302409 Nebula
Total Output626.93302409 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
383623 Confirmations626.93302409 Nebula
Raw Transaction